Seljuk Gold Signet Ring for Yusef Abdullah

12TH-13TH CENTURY A.D.

1 in. (10.67 grams, 22.81 mm overall, 15.48 mm internal diameter (approximate size British J, USA 4 3/4, Europe 8.69, Japan 8)).

With D-section hoop, scooped shoulders each with an incised heart-shaped motif, raised square bezel with Kufic inscription 'Yusef Abdullah'. [No Reserve]
